What is the Body Mass Index?
The body mass index is a simple metric derived by dividing an individual's weight in kilograms by their height in meters squared. The resulting numerical value falls within a spectrum categorizing weight status, offering crucial insights into potential health risks. Understanding these classifications is key to proactive health management.

Classifications Based on BMI:
The NHLBI (National Heart, Lung, and Blood Institute) provides a standardized framework for interpreting BMI scores. This framework categorizes individuals into specific weight status categories:
- Underweight: A BMI below 18.5 kg/m² indicates an underweight condition. This category, while sometimes associated with certain health conditions, is frequently linked to a deficiency in essential nutrients and can be a cause for concern. Recognizing the signs and seeking professional guidance is paramount.
- Normal Weight: A BMI between 18.5 and 24.9 kg/m² is typically considered healthy. This range generally corresponds to a favorable balance between weight and height, minimizing potential risks associated with excessive or insufficient body weight.
- Overweight: A BMI ranging from 25.0 to 29.9 kg/m² signifies an overweight condition. This category often correlates with an increased risk of chronic illnesses. It's critical to understand that this is not an absolute marker of disease, but rather a signal for a potential need for lifestyle adjustments.
- Obesity: A BMI of 30.0 kg/m² or higher indicates obesity, and this is frequently associated with increased health risks, encompassing a multitude of diseases. Obesity underscores the importance of comprehensive medical evaluations and personalized interventions.

Beyond the Numbers: The Limitations of BMI
Acknowledging the limitations of the BMI is vital. This metric, while a helpful starting point, should never replace thorough medical assessments and individualized recommendations. Individuals with significant muscle mass, athletes, and those with specific medical conditions may have BMI readings that don't fully reflect their health status. In such cases, a healthcare provider can offer valuable insight and appropriate interventions.

Solution 1: Understanding the BMI Calculation
- Step 1: Gather the necessary data. You need your weight in kilograms (kg) and your height in meters (m). If your measurements are in pounds and inches, you will need a conversion. 1 kg = 2.20462 pounds and 1 meter = 39.370 inches. For example, 150 lbs and 5'10" (1.78 m) need conversion to the metric system.* Step 2: Perform the BMI calculation. The formula is: BMI = weight (kg) / [height (m)]². Using the example above, a person weighing 68 kg and measuring 1.78 meters would have a BMI of 68 / (1.78)² = 21.4.* Real-world example: Imagine a 30-year-old woman, Sarah, who weighs 160 lbs and is 5'4" (1.63m) tall. Converting to kilograms: 160 lbs = 73 kg. Calculating the BMI: 73 / (1.63)² = 27.7. Sarah's BMI is 27.7, which falls into the overweight category.* Digestible Breakdown: The BMI calculation is straightforward.
